Chandigarh, January 25

The CBI Court has ordered to frame charges against Vijay Sehra, Superintendent, Central Goods and Services Tax (CGST), who was arrested for allegedly demanding and accepting a bribe of Rs20,000 from a complainant.

The CBI had registered a case against Sehra, Superintendent, CGST, Sector 17, Chandigarh, under Section 7 of the Prevention of Corruption Act, 1988 (as amended in 2018) on the basis of a complaint of Subhash Chand Dadhwal.

Advertisement

Dadhwal alleged that the accused, Vijay Sehra, told him to pay bribe to settle his tax issue. As the complainant did not want to pay the bribe, he made a written complaint to the CBI.

The CBI team laid a trap and the accused was caught red-handed while demanding and accepting Rs20,000 from the complainant in the presence of independent witnesses.
